Meaning of want to | Babel Free

Phrase CEFR B2
/ˈwʌn tu/

Definitions

  1. Used other than figuratively or idiomatically: see want, to.
  2. About to; indicates imminent action.
    Malaysia, Singapore, Singlish

Examples

“Want to rain already.”

It’s about to rain.

“This poster like want to fall off already.”

This poster’s about to fall off.
